refactor(tests): make the responses tests nicer (#3161)

# What does this PR do?

A _bunch_ on cleanup for the Responses tests.

- Got rid of YAML test cases, moved them to just use simple pydantic models
- Splitting the large monolithic test file into multiple focused test files:
   - `test_basic_responses.py` for basic and image response tests
   - `test_tool_responses.py` for tool-related tests
   - `test_file_search.py` for file search specific tests
- Adding a `StreamingValidator` helper class to standardize streaming response validation

## Test Plan

Run the tests:

```
pytest -s -v tests/integration/non_ci/responses/ \
   --stack-config=starter \
   --text-model openai/gpt-4o \
   --embedding-model=sentence-transformers/all-MiniLM-L6-v2 \
    -k "client_with_models"
```

import time
def new_vector_store(openai_client, name):
"""Create a new vector store, cleaning up any existing one with the same name."""
# Ensure we don't reuse an existing vector store
vector_stores = openai_client.vector_stores.list()
for vector_store in vector_stores:
if vector_store.name == name:
openai_client.vector_stores.delete(vector_store_id=vector_store.id)
# Create a new vector store
vector_store = openai_client.vector_stores.create(name=name)
return vector_store
def upload_file(openai_client, name, file_path):
"""Upload a file, cleaning up any existing file with the same name."""
# Ensure we don't reuse an existing file
files = openai_client.files.list()
for file in files:
if file.filename == name:
openai_client.files.delete(file_id=file.id)
# Upload a text file with our document content
return openai_client.files.create(file=open(file_path, "rb"), purpose="assistants")
def wait_for_file_attachment(compat_client, vector_store_id, file_id):
"""Wait for a file to be attached to a vector store."""
file_attach_response = compat_client.vector_stores.files.retrieve(
vector_store_id=vector_store_id,
file_id=file_id,
)
while file_attach_response.status == "in_progress":
time.sleep(0.1)
file_attach_response = compat_client.vector_stores.files.retrieve(
vector_store_id=vector_store_id,
file_id=file_id,
)
assert file_attach_response.status == "completed", f"Expected file to be attached, got {file_attach_response}"
assert not file_attach_response.last_error
return file_attach_response
def setup_mcp_tools(tools, mcp_server_info):
"""Replace placeholder MCP server URLs with actual server info."""
# Create a deep copy to avoid modifying the original test case
import copy
tools_copy = copy.deepcopy(tools)
for tool in tools_copy:
if tool["type"] == "mcp" and tool["server_url"] == "<FILLED_BY_TEST_RUNNER>":
tool["server_url"] = mcp_server_info["server_url"]
return tools_copy
